Here`s what I just find on Timo`s facebook, I try to translate it in eglish here, as best as I can.Damn it would be great to participate in this event, but I`m afraid that I dont have money to this :(

Translation:
2-day Guitarseminar
"guitar beyond Infinity" In april at Helsinki. Limited turnout. In seminar we deal with guitar playing and music comprehensively. Seminar costs 600e/1-person and from that 100e prepaymen. I have keep this seminar before in Europe and in South America hundreds of times. For more info :
info@kitarakoulu.com
